Transaction 68ecc0874f1fea75351f7f74d050b67c9684b1b30e2cd74c2eb6a9b96a21bc10
1 Input
1 Output
-
68ecc0874f1fea75351f7f74d050b67c9684b1b30e2cd74c2eb6a9b96a21bc10:0
- value
- 28748434
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db5b37ed1f36b1520f6ef5f3d90fdf38932f671f OP_EQUAL
- address
- 3MgsBXNYoXpgMFeTTZeL3XmF8Av3N5resT